Deploy step 4 — Pointsmith Ledger

Drain the old ledger writer before cutover. Verify the loyalty-points balance snapshot matches the reconciliation job output from last night; any drift over 0.1% blocks the deploy. Flip LEDGER_WRITE_MODE to dual in ledger.env, then restart the Pointsmith workers on the Karville cluster. The ledger signing credential must sit directly under the write-mode line, so append it next.

env line for fafof-fahag: LEDGER_TOKEN5=f8790

Vendor note: TilePath prefetcher. The prefetch service is maintained by Harwick Geo Systems under contract renewal every March. Their SLA covers tile-cache warmup latency only, not upstream basemap outages, so log those separately before filing a ticket. Keep the vendor's change calendar in mind; they freeze deployments during the Kellmore trade show week. For any contract, SLA, or escalation question, reach the Harwick account desk directly.

alerts address for bajop-yahog: istwyn@lumiclabs.internal

## Handover: Meterline Per-Tenant Quotas

To the on-call engineer: the Meterline quota service is mid-migration from static per-tenant limits to the new adaptive tier table. Tenants on the legacy path still read from the old config map, so do not delete it even though it looks unused. If the adaptive service falls over, flip the `quota_fallback` flag and all tenants revert to legacy limits within one minute. The fallback console is sealed; to open it during an incident, enter the recovery passphrase directly below.

vault phrase of tahop-kagag = ralok-lamvan-gilok-ralmir-fraion